CurrentMusic Victoria is an independent, not-for-profit organisation and the state peak body for contemporary music. Music Victoria represents musicians, venues, music businesses and professionals, and music lovers across the contemporary Victorian music community. Music Victoria provides advocacy on behalf of the music sector, actively supports the development of the Victorian music community, and celebrates and promotes Victorian music.

The Emerging Writers’ Festival is a not-for-profit organisation whose foundations are built on supporting emerging writers. The Festival celebrates creativity and innovation, nurturing new talent and is a place where diverse voices from across Australia are represented.

The Australia & New Zealand Tessitura Regional Users Conference (ANZTRUC) is a not-for-profit conference attended by licensees and users of the Tessitura CRM platform in the Asia Pacific region. ANZTRUC is the only multi-disciplinary conference for arts professionals in Australia and features local and international guests, general keynote sessions, peer-to-peer presentations, labs, networking opportunities and much more, designed to bring users together in an open and collaborative setting.
